Warning Signs You Need Portable Pump Water Extraction
Ignoring the warning signs of water damage can lead to more severe issues down the line, including mold growth, structural damage, and costly repairs. Don’t wait – act quickly.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Unpleasant odors that linger in your home or business can be a sign of hidden water damage. Don’t ignore the smell. Investigate the source.
Warped or Discolored Flooring
Visible signs of water damage, such as warped or discolored flooring, can show a larger issue. Don’t dismiss the signs. Take action.
Water Stains on Ceilings or Walls
Water stains on ceilings or walls can be a sign of a leak or burst pipe. Don’t ignore the stains. Fix the issue.
Increased Water Bills
Sudden spikes in your water bills can show a hidden leak or water issue. Don’t dismiss the bill. Investigate the issue.
Water Damage on Appliances
Visible signs of water damage on appliances, such as a water-logged washing machine, can show a larger issue. Don’t dismiss the damage. Fix the appliance.

Portable Pump Water Extraction Cost in Summit Park, UT
The cost of portable pump water extraction in Summit Park, UT, varies based on factors like the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on real-world costs and can serve as a guide. Don’t budget without an on-site assessment. Get a free estimate today.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Initial Assessment and Planning | $200-$1,000 | Size and complexity of the job, equipment and crew required |
| Water Removal and Extraction | $500-$2,500 | Volume of water, equipment and crew required, time and labor costs |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$300-$1,500 | Size and complexity of the job, equipment and crew required, time and labor costs |
| Restoration and Reconstruction | $1,000-$5,000 | Size and complexity of the job, materials and labor costs, time required |
| Insurance Claims and Documentation | $100-$500 | Complexity of the claims process, time and labor costs, documentation requirements |
| Equipment and Labor for Large or Complex Jobs | $1,500-$10,000 | Size and complexity of the job, equipment and crew required, time and labor costs |
